Early Times Report
Jammu, Sept 18: With the aim of promoting mental health, stress management, positive human behaviour and mental alertness during duty among the running staff, Northern Railway, Jammu Division today organized a “Mental Health and Stress Management Programme for Running Staff” successfully at the Conference Hall, Divisional Manager’s Office, Jammu on 18th September. The programme was organized under the leadership of Divisional Railway Manager, Jammu, Shri Vivek Kumar and under the guidance of Sr. Divisional Electrical Engineer (Traction), Jammu, Shri Gurnam Singh. Running staff of various categories posted at Jammu Headquarters participated in large numbers and benefited from counselling and awareness sessions related to mental health and stress management. During the programme, experts provided detailed counselling on important subjects like stress management, mind control techniques, memory improvement, pain management, human behaviour and psychological issues. The main objective of the programme was to enable the running staff to deal effectively with stressful situations, maintain concentration and mental alertness, and remain aware of better mental and physical health during duty.
